Franz Ferdinand Stream New Album ‘Right Thoughts, Right Words, Right Action’

We always suspected that Scottish lads Franz Ferdinand were a bunch of nice guys, and they’re proving it by streaming their latest album, Right Thoughts, Right Words, Right Actions (below) a full three days ahead of its official Aussie release date via NPR.

Early singles Right Action and Love Illumination are good indicators of what to expect from RTRWRA: the latest effort from the quintet doesn’t seem to be breaking too much new ground, but if you’re a fan of what The Franz do you won’t be disappointed. We are, and we weren’t.

Franz Ferdinand will be heading Down Under to appear at Harvest Festival this November, where hopefully frontman Alex Kapranos will have better luck at avoiding peanut-induced allergic reactions than he did at Sziget Festival in Budapest last week.
